Output 15d03312611ad31aab566467c0bf44f26deab5afe04ae6ea75a05943ce97c305:0

value
1091241
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38ff6f4f5ba2a4b13c46044330b7644d7c5e82c4 OP_EQUALVERIFY OP_CHECKSIG
address
16CNqfWGatC5dxhbdnZmDqmjunL6VCHBRo
transaction
15d03312611ad31aab566467c0bf44f26deab5afe04ae6ea75a05943ce97c305
spent
true